BEFORE TAKEOFF
(Continued)
5. Fuel Boost Switch
-
RECHECK NORM.
/=
6. Fuel Tank Selectors
-
RECHECK BOTH ON.
7. Fuel Quantity
-
RECHECK.
8.
Fuel Shutoff
-
RECHECK FULLY ON.
,
-
9. Elevator, Aileron, and Rudder Trim Controls
-
SET for takeoff.
,
.
10.Power Lever
-
400 FT-LBS.
A. Suction Gage -CHECK.
f=
B. Volt/Ammeter
-
CHECK and return selector to BATT position.
f.z
C.
Inertial Separator
-
CHECK. Turn control counterclockwise,
pull to BYPASS position and check torque drop; move control
,.
back to NORMAL position and check that original torque is
regained.
D. Engine Instruments
-
CHECK (See Section 2, Limitations for
minimum oil temperature required for flight).
1l.Overspeed Governor
-
CHECK (stabilized at 1750 t60 RPM)
(See Systems Checks).
12.Power Lever
-
IDLE.
13.Quadrant Friction Lock
-
ADJUST.
14.Standby Power (if installed)
-
CHECK (See Systems Checks).
(
15.Autopilot (if installed)
-
PREFLIGHT TEST (See Systems
Checks).
1
16.Known Icing System (if installed)
-
PREFLIGHT COMPLETE
(See Systems Checks) prior to any flight in icing conditions.
I
17.PitoffStatic Heat
-
ON when OAT is below 4°C (39°F).
18.lce Protection (if installed) -AS REQUIRED.
19.Avionics and Radar (if installed) -CHECK and SET.
20.GPSINAV Switch -SET.
21 .Strobe Lights
-
AS REQUIRED.
22.Annunciators
-
EXTINGUISHED or considered.
23.Wing Flaps -SET at 20".
24.Cabin Heat Mixing Air Control
-
FLT-PUSH.
25.Window
-
CLOSE.
26.Brakes
-
RELEASE.
27.Fuel Condition Lever
-
HIGH IDLE.
28.Standby Power Switch (if installed)
-
ON (Standby Power INOP
Annunciator
-
OFF).
